We are a Plumbing and Heating company based in a unit in Harston. We are looking to recruit for a Customer Service Apprentice. We are seeking a professional and organised Receptionist to join our team. The successful candidate will be the first point of contact for visitors and callers, providing excellent customer service and ensuring smooth administrative operations.

This role offers an excellent opportunity for individuals with office experience who are eager to contribute to a dynamic workplace environment. The position is ideal for candidates looking to develop their administrative skills within a supportive team.

Main roles and responsibilities:
  • Greet visitors and clients in a courteous and professional manner.
  • Manage incoming calls, directing them appropriately with proper phone etiquette.
  • Scheduling and organising appointments for the clients.
  • Managing emails.
  • Managing a team of engineers' daily diaries.
  • Assist with general administrative tasks including filing, photocopying, and organising documents.
  • Update and maintain records with organisational skills ensuring information is current and accessible.
Entry requirements:
  • GCSE Maths and English at grades 4 or above required.
Skills required:
  • Customer care skills
  • Logical
  • Initiative

Training to be provided: The learner will be studying the Customer Service Practitioner Level 2 Apprenticeship Standard qualification.

Things to consider: The role does require long periods of working on a computer, however regular breaks are provided. The workplace is in a remote location with no public transport links, so a car and driver's license would be essential. The role is initially for the duration of the apprenticeship, however this may be extended to a permanent position on completion of the apprenticeship.

How to prepare for a job interview at Futures Job Shop 002

✨Know the Company

Before your interview, take some time to research Nutcombe Cambridge. Understand their services, values, and what makes them unique in the plumbing and heating industry. This knowledge will help you answer questions more conf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

✨Practice Your Customer Service Skills

As a receptionist, you'll be the first point of contact for visitors and callers. Prepare by practising common customer service scenarios. Think about how you would greet someone, handle a complaint, or manage multiple calls. This will help you demonstrate your customer care skills during the interview.

✨Showcase Your Organisational Skills

The role requires strong organisational abilities. Be ready to discuss how you've managed tasks in the past, like scheduling appointments or keeping records. You could even bring examples of how you've organised documents or handled administrative tasks in previous roles or during your studies.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team you'll be working with, the training provided, or what a typical day looks like. This shows your enthusiasm for the position and helps you determine if it's the right fit for you.
